Bash 脚本中的括号108


在 Bash 脚本中,括号是一种用于组织代码和控制程序流的语法元素。它们有三种主要类型:小括号、中括号和大括号,每种类型都有其独特的目的。

小括号

小括号 () 用于以下目的:* 命令组:将多个命令分组,形成一个子 shell。子 shell 中的更改不会影响主 shell。
* 命令替换:将命令的输出用作另一个命令的参数。
* 进程替换:将进程的输入或输出重定向到文件或其他进程。

例如:```bash
(echo "命令组中") # 子 shell 中的命令
echo "$(date)" # 命令替换,打印当前日期
exec 3

2024-12-02


上一篇:创建一个Bash脚本来自动化任务

下一篇:[Bash 脚本程序:初学者指南]